They surely haven't. The 2000s and 2010s spoiled employers because every other kid joining the labor pool spent hours a day on their computer, developing an aptitude for technology in general. For them it was a short leap from their home computer to running a retail or fast food POS. That party is now over but most businesses still depend on desktop and laptop computing for much of their business operations and expectations haven't caught up. |
